Tokushima, located on the island of Shikoku, is a city rich in natural beauty and cultural heritage. Known for its traditional Awa Odori dance, stunning landscapes, and unique local cuisine, Tokushima offers an array of guided tours that cater to diverse interests. Visitors are drawn to the city not only for its cultural experiences but also for its adventurous outdoor activities amidst lush mountains and scenic coastlines.

Best day trips from Tokushima

Tokushima serves as an ideal base for day trips to explore nearby stunning destinations. With various options to experience the beauty of Shikoku and beyond, these day trips allow you to venture beyond city limits without much hassle. Here are some top recommendations:

Naoshima Island

Just a ferry ride away, Naoshima is renowned for its contemporary art museums and installations. A day trip can take about 3 hours total travel time, making it a great outdoor artistic experience.

Shimanami Kaido

This famous cycling route connects Shikoku and Honshu islands, offering breathtaking views. It’s perfect for cycling enthusiasts and takes around 1.5 hours to reach the starting point.

Oboke and Iya Valley

These scenic valleys are accessible within 1 hour and are known for their stunning gorges and traditional vine bridges. Ideal for nature walks and photography.

Awaguriyama Nature Park

A tranquil escape located approximately 30 minutes from Tokushima, great for hiking and enjoying panoramic views of the region.
